The Cultural Significance of the Eye of Horus
Rooted in Egyptian mythology, the Eye of Horus represented protection, health, and royal power. Historically, it was linked to the myth of Horus, the sky god, who lost his left eye in a conflict with Set, only to have it restored—symbolising healing and restoration. Archaeological discoveries, such as amulets bearing the Eye’s likeness, highlight its importance in both religious rituals and personal talismans. Its enduring symbolic potency continues to inspire modern representations, including those in visual arts and digital entertainment.
